/**
* This is a base dialog that uses TreeViewer to show selections, subclass needs
* to provide IContentProvider, ILabelProvider and ViewerFilter for the
* TreeViewer. Subclass needs to implement isValidSelection(), which valids the
* selection, and findInputElement() which provides the root element of the
* tree. Besides, subclass might need to implement getResult() to return a
* customized result.
*
* @author mengbo
*
*/
public abstract class TreeViewerSelectionDialog extends SelectionDialog {
private static final String DEFAULT_TITLE = JSFUICommonPlugin
.getResourceString("Dialog.TreeViewerSelectionDialog.DefaultTitle"); //$NON-NLS-1$
/** Used to tag the image type */
public static final int STYLE_NONE = 0;
private static final int STYLE_INFORMATION = 1;
private static final int STYLE_ERROR = 2;
private static final int STYLE_WARNING = 3;
/** Sizi of the TreeViewer composite */
private static final int SIZING_SELECTION_PANE_HEIGHT = 300;
private static final int SIZING_SELECTION_PANE_WIDTH = 320;
private String _title = DEFAULT_TITLE;
// the seleciton on the treeviewer.
private static Object[] _selection;
// providers
private ITreeContentProvider _contentProvider;
private ILabelProvider _labelProvider;
private ViewerFilter _filter;
/** The validation image */
private Label _statusImage;
/** The validation message */
private Label _statusLabel;
private String _statusMessage;
/** The selection tree */
private TreeViewer _treeViewer;
private int _style;
private ViewerSorter _viewerSorter = null;
private ViewerComparator _viewerComparator = null;
/**
* @param parentShell
* @param statusMessage
* @param style
*/
public TreeViewerSelectionDialog(Shell parentShell, String statusMessage,
int style) {
super(parentShell);
_statusMessage = statusMessage;
_style = style;
setShellStyle(SWT.CLOSE | SWT.TITLE | SWT.BORDER
| SWT.APPLICATION_MODAL | SWT.RESIZE);
}
/**
* Convenience for TreeViewerSelectionDialog(parentShell, statusMessage, SWT.NONE)
*
* @param parentShell
* @param statusMessage
*/
public TreeViewerSelectionDialog(Shell parentShell, String statusMessage) {
this(parentShell, statusMessage, SWT.NONE);
}
public void setTitle(String title) {
super.setTitle(title);
_title = title;
}
/**
* Returns a new drill down viewer for this dialog.
* @param parent
*/
protected void createTreeViewer(Composite parent) {
// Create drill down
DrillDownComposite drillDown = new DrillDownComposite(parent,
SWT.BORDER);
GridData spec = new GridData(GridData.FILL_BOTH);
spec.widthHint = SIZING_SELECTION_PANE_WIDTH;
spec.heightHint = SIZING_SELECTION_PANE_HEIGHT;
drillDown.setLayoutData(spec);
_treeViewer = new TreeViewer(drillDown, _style);
drillDown.setChildTree(_treeViewer);
}
private void setTreeViewerProviders() {
_treeViewer.setContentProvider(_contentProvider);
_treeViewer.setLabelProvider(_labelProvider);
if (_viewerSorter == null) {
_viewerSorter = new ViewerSorter();
}
_treeViewer.setSorter(_viewerSorter);
// override if not null.. setSorter is discouraged.
if (_viewerComparator != null)
{
_treeViewer.setComparator(_viewerComparator);
}
_treeViewer.addSelectionChangedListener(new ISelectionChangedListener() {
public void selectionChanged(SelectionChangedEvent event) {
_selection = getSelectedElements((IStructuredSelection) event
.getSelection());
updateStatus();
}
});
_treeViewer.addDoubleClickListener(new IDoubleClickListener() {
public void doubleClick(DoubleClickEvent event) {
ISelection selection = event.getSelection();
if (selection instanceof IStructuredSelection) {
Object item = ((IStructuredSelection) selection)
.getFirstElement();
if (item instanceof IFile) {
okPressed();
} else if (_treeViewer.getExpandedState(item)) {
_treeViewer.collapseToLevel(item, 1);
} else {
_treeViewer.expandToLevel(item, 1);
}
}
}
});
_treeViewer.setInput(findInputElement());
if (_filter != null) {
_treeViewer.addFilter(_filter);
}
}
/**
* Creates the contents of the composite.
* @param parent
*/
protected void createTreeViewerComposite(Composite parent) {
Composite treeViewerComposite = new Composite(parent, SWT.NONE);
GridLayout layout = new GridLayout();
layout.marginWidth = 0;
treeViewerComposite.setLayout(layout);
GridData gridData = new GridData(GridData.FILL_HORIZONTAL);
gridData.horizontalSpan = 2;
treeViewerComposite.setLayoutData(gridData);
Label label = new Label(treeViewerComposite, SWT.WRAP);
label.setText(_title);
label.setFont(treeViewerComposite.getFont());
createTreeViewer(treeViewerComposite);
Dialog.applyDialogFont(treeViewerComposite);
}
/**
* Sets the selected existing container.
* @param selection
*/
public void setSelectedElement(Object[] selection) {
// Expand to and select the specified container
if (selection == null) {
return;
}
for (int i = 0; i < selection.length; i++) {
if (_selection[i] != null) {
_treeViewer.expandToLevel(_selection[i], 1);
}
}
_treeViewer.setSelection(new StructuredSelection(selection), true);
}
/*
* (non-Javadoc) Method declared on Dialog.
*/
protected Control createDialogArea(Composite parent) {
Composite area = (Composite) super.createDialogArea(parent);
GridLayout gridLayout = new GridLayout();
gridLayout.numColumns = 2;
area.setLayout(gridLayout);
// Container treeviewer composite
createTreeViewerComposite(area);
_statusImage = createLabel(area);
_statusImage.setImage(getMessageImage(STYLE_ERROR));
_statusLabel = createLabel(area);
// Link to model
setTreeViewerProviders();
return dialogArea;
}
private Label createLabel(Composite parent) {
Label label = new Label(parent, SWT.LEFT);
GridData data = new GridData();
data.horizontalSpan = 1;
data.horizontalAlignment = GridData.FILL;
label.setLayoutData(data);
label.setText(_statusMessage == null ? "" : _statusMessage); //$NON-NLS-1$
return label;
}
private Object[] getSelectedElements(IStructuredSelection selection) {
return selection.toArray();
}
/**
* @param provider
* The _contentProvider to set.
*/
public void setContentProvider(ITreeContentProvider provider) {
_contentProvider = provider;
}
/**
* @param provider
* The _labelProvider to set.
*/
public void setLabelProvider(ILabelProvider provider) {
_labelProvider = provider;
}
/**
* @param filter
* The _filter to set.
*/
public void setFilter(ViewerFilter filter) {
this._filter = filter;
}
/**
* @param sorter
* The _viewerSorter to set.
*/
public void setViewerSorter(ViewerSorter sorter) {
_viewerSorter = sorter;
}
/**
* Set the viewer comparator. If not null, it's set after after the
* viewer sorter and thus overrides it.
*
* @param viewerComparator
*/
public void setViewerComparator(ViewerComparator viewerComparator)
{
_viewerComparator = viewerComparator;
}
/**
* @param message
*/
public void setStatusMessage(String message) {
_statusMessage = message;
}
/**
* Update the status message
*/
private void updateStatus() {
Object selection = _selection;
if (_selection != null && _selection.length == 1) {
selection = _selection[0];
}
if (isValidSelection(selection)) {
_statusImage.setVisible(false);
_statusLabel.setText(""); //$NON-NLS-1$
getOkButton().setEnabled(true);
} else {
_statusImage.setVisible(true);
_statusImage.setImage(getMessageImage(STYLE_ERROR));
_statusImage.redraw();
_statusLabel.setText(_statusMessage);
getOkButton().setEnabled(false);
}
}
/**
* Get the different message according the message type.
* @param imageType
*
* @return Image - the message image
*/
protected Image getMessageImage(int imageType) {
switch (imageType) {
case STYLE_ERROR:
return JFaceResources.getImage(Dialog.DLG_IMG_MESSAGE_ERROR);
case STYLE_WARNING:
return JFaceResources.getImage(Dialog.DLG_IMG_MESSAGE_WARNING);
case STYLE_INFORMATION:
return JFaceResources.getImage(Dialog.DLG_IMG_MESSAGE_INFO);
default:
return null;
}
}
/**
* The <code>ContainerSelectionDialog</code> implementation of this
* <code>Dialog</code> method builds a list of the selected resource
* containers for later retrieval by the client and closes this dialog.
*/
protected void okPressed() {
List chosenContainerPathList = new ArrayList();
if (_selection != null) {
chosenContainerPathList.addAll(Arrays.asList(_selection));
}
setResult(chosenContainerPathList);
super.okPressed();
}
/*
* (non-Javadoc)
*
* @see org.eclipse.jface.window.Window#createContents(org.eclipse.swt.widgets.Composite)
*/
protected Control createContents(Composite parent) {
Control control = super.createContents(parent);
if (_selection != null) {
this.setSelectedElement(_selection);
}
return control;
}
/**
* @param selection
* @return true if selection is valid
*/
protected abstract boolean isValidSelection(Object selection);
/**
* Used to set the input element on the tree viewer
* @return the input element
*/
protected abstract Object findInputElement();
}
